Cooper guest casts judgment on Sparkman case
“We’re being very cautious about what we’re reporting on this and what we’re saying,” said Anderson Cooper on Friday night about the death of U.S. Census worker Bill Sparkman. Only here’s the thing: He’s not being cautious at all. In fact, he allowed a guest to ramble on for two minutes about the probably that the gruesome deed was done by an anti-government extremist; a conclusion that is looking increasingly unlikely, by the way.
